Quick answer

Barue is a village in Amta - I Sub-District of Haora district in West Bengal. Its Census location code is 332656.

About Barue village record

Barue is listed under Amta - I Sub-District in Haora district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 3,850, 693 households, area 257.15 hectares, PIN code 711408.
